
Real Madrid are reportedly preparing to open talks with Chelsea over the future of midfielder Enzo Fernandez, in a potential move that would reshape the summer transfer landscape for both clubs. The development has sparked fresh attention around Fernandez’s next destination, with Real Madrid positioning themselves as serious contenders to secure the Argentine international.
The report frames this as an early-stage negotiation process, with Real Madrid set to begin discussions with Chelsea rather than already having a deal agreed.
